See also [rocq-prover.org/community](https://rocq-prover.org/community), which lists several other active platforms. ## Bug reports Please report any bug / feature request in [our issue tracker](https://github.com/rocq-prover/rocq/issues). To be effective, bug reports should mention the OCaml version used to compile and run Rocq, the Rocq version (`coqtop -v` or `rocq -v`), the configuration used, and include a complete source example leading to the bug. ## Contributing to Rocq Guidelines for contributing to Rocq in various ways are listed in the [contributor's guide](CONTRIBUTING.md).
